The Summit Fire that ignited Thursday morning (this fire is about 20 miles away from our house) It quickly devoured 3,200 acres and at least 10 homes in the Santa Cruz Mountains may be contained quicker thanks to cooler temperatures, a shift in wind direction to the south, fog and higher humidity.
The Quail Hollow Fire, which is MUCH closer to our house (approximately 3 miles away.) Has been fully contained!
